(LIVE) Resilience for lawyers in post-Covid times (2022)

We’re all continuing to live through testing times. We often talk about resilience but what do we actually mean by it? And how can we, as lawyers and human beings, achieve it in both our home lives and our working lives?

In this session, Annmarie Carvalho, therapist, lawyer and mediator (non-practising) at The Carvalho Consultancy and Lucinda Soon, PhD researcher in Organisational Psychology at Birkbeck, University of London, explain:

  • The real causes of a ‘lack of resilience’
  • Typical unhelpful thinking styles of lawyers
  • How to tackle such thinking styles
  • How we can both talk and act our way into increased resilience
